A thin lens is placed 50cm from an illustrated object. The image produced has linear magnification of \(\frac{1}{4}\). Calculate the power of the lens in diopters
- A. 2.5D
- B. 5.0D
- C. 10.0D
- D. 25.0D
Correct Answer: C. 10.0D
